The Chief - Paul Harrogan - joins Barry Toohey in Episode 5 of Toohey's News, opening up about his early years with the Newcastle Knights, his hunger to play first-grade football, and the heady days of the Knight's unforgettable rise to grand final glory in 1997.

But Harrogan's road to glory has been paved with hardship. The years before his meteoric rise to footballing fame in 1992 were plagued by injury and strife. He opens up with Barry Toohey on the hard road to the heights of representative football, including how he became embroiled in the infamous showdown between the ARL and News Limited that came to be known as the Super League War.
